""'Creasy and Creasy is the 'go to' reference on my bookshelf when
I am searching for thoughts on current production systems. Given
the authors' experience, there is good awareness of viticultural
practices in different climate zones... I trust readers will find
as much benefit and enjoyment with this updated volume as I found
with the first."' Dr. Richard Smart, 'the flying vine-doctor',
Cornwall, UK Fully revised with new content and full-colour figures
throughout, the second edition of this successful book contains
expanded content for all sections, particularly those covering the
impact of climate change, seasonal management, mechanisation and
organic management options. There is a new vine balance section, as
well as significant updates to rootstocks and grafting. It includes
information on wine grapes in addition to grapes for fresh
consumption and raisin production. Covering a broad range of topics
from grapevine growth and fruit development, to vineyard
establishment, mechanisation and postharvest processing, this book
provides historical and current information about the grape
industry and sets out the theory and science behind production
practices. It is an invaluable resource for grape producers,
horticulture and plant science students, as well as enthusiasts of
the vine and its products.
